International: May 29th Anniversaries

  • 1453: Constantinople is taken by the Turks, ending the Byzantine Empire.
  • 1856: Inauguration of the telegraph line between Caracas and La Guaira, the first to operate in Venezuela.
  • 1934: The United States and Cuba sign a treaty that includes the abolition of the Platt Amendment and the total independence of the island.
  • 1953: New Zealander Edmund P. Hillary, accompanied by the Sherpa Tensing Norgay, ascends, for the first time, to the summit of Everest.
  • 1966: The Azteca Stadium in Mexico City is inaugurated.
  • 1970: Former Argentine President Pedro Eugenio Aramburu is kidnapped and later assassinated by a group that is known for the first time as the "Montoneros".
  • 1985: 39 people die and 117 others are injured in the Heysel Stadium in Brussels during a stampede caused by English fans before the start of the European Cup Final football match, which Juventus won against Liverpool.
  • 2005: Nearly two million participants in the Sao Paulo Gay Pride Parade demand that the Government approve a law on marriage between people of the same sex.
  • 2014: The Ecuadorian Justice sentences former President Jamil Mahuad to 12 years in prison for embezzlement of public funds.
  • 2015: Cuba officially comes off the list of state sponsors of terrorism that the US annually draws up.
  • 2020: A prosecutor charges former Argentine President Mauricio Macri and his former intelligence chief with alleged espionage.
  • 2021: Thousands of people demonstrate in more than 200 cities in Brazil against President Jair Bolsonaro, and "for life", with more vaccines and aid to the poor to face the pandemic.
  • 2023: Former Salvadoran President Mauricio Funes (2009-2014) is sentenced to 14 years in prison for crimes during his term.

Births: May 29th Anniversaries

  • 1801: Pedro Santana, military and politician.
  • 1903: Bob Hope, American comedian actor.
  • 1917: John F. Kennedy, US president.
  • 1942: Oscar Alzaga, Spanish politician, lawyer and professor.
  • 1955: Carme Forcadell Lluis, Spanish politician.
  • 1956: La Toya Jackson, American singer.
  • 1979: Fonseca (Juan Fernando Fonseca), Colombian composer and singer.
  • 1982: Ana Beatriz Barros, Brazilian model.

Deaths: May 29th Anniversaries

  • 1857: Agustina de Aragón, Spanish heroine of the war of independence against the French.
  • 1958: Juan Ramón Jiménez, Spanish writer and Nobel Prize winner 1956.
  • 2003: Armando Llamas, Spanish-Argentine writer and playwright.
  • 2010: Dennis Hopper, American actor.
  • 2017: Manuel Antonio Noriega, Panamanian dictator.
  • 2019: José María Blanco Ibarz, Spanish comic artist.
  • 2020: Abderramán Yusufi, Moroccan politician.
  • 2021: B.J. Thomas, American singer.
  • 2023: Thomas Buergenthal, one of the founders of the Inter-American Court of Human Rights.
